نمایش نتایج 1 تا 3 از 3

نام تاپیک: تبديل نوع int به LPCTSTR

  1. #1
    کاربر جدید
    تاریخ عضویت
    مرداد 1387
    محل زندگی
    ایران
    پست
    15

    Lightbulb تبديل نوع int به LPCTSTR

    سلام
    در يك برنامه نياز دارم تا عددي را در يك Edit control قرار بدم با استفاده از متد :
    کد HTML:
    void SetWindowText(LPCTSTR lpszString )
    ولي نميدونم چجوري int را به LPCTSTR تبديل كنم ، اگه اين تبديل اصلا امكان نداره ،امكان اين هست كه به CString تبديل كنم بعد CString را به LPCTSTR تبديل كنم يا هر واسطه ي ديگه.

  2. #2
    کاربر دائمی آواتار clover
    تاریخ عضویت
    خرداد 1388
    محل زندگی
    اصفهان - اراک
    پست
    646

    نقل قول: تبديل نوع int به LPCTSTR

    انواع رشته ای اشاره گر هستند ، تا جایی که می دونم به صورت مستقیم (با تبدیل نوع) نیمتونی عدد را در تابع مذکور استفاده کنی .
    یکی از روش ها اینه که با استفاده از تابع itow_ عدد مورد نظر را در یک بافر رشته قرار بدی و در تابع SetWindowText از این رشته استفاده کنی :
    int i = 555;
    WCHAR buffer[10];
    _itow(i, buffer, 10);
    SetWindowText((LPCWSTR)buffer);

  3. #3

    نقل قول: تبديل نوع int به LPCTSTR

    جواب در FAQ شماره 11

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•